China Beijing Beijing Alibaba Cloud
Websites on 101.200.54.104
- Domain names that have been bound:
- 2023-10-23-----2026-03-10liuxue521.com
- 2020-08-28-----2026-02-11xgxgroup.cn
- 2025-12-03-----2025-12-03www.liuxue521.com
- 2021-10-30-----2025-11-1321sjlx.com
- 2024-12-13-----2025-06-14www.21sjlx.com
- 2022-03-11-----2022-03-11www.xgxgroup.cn
- 2019-08-26-----2019-12-01www.peixunok.cn
- website server lookup history
- 720486.com
- ahmadawais.com
- baoyu.19333.com
- www.9k.com
- yadongkorea.org
- bosworthcollege.com
- 2waky.com
- www.fff668.com
- lzchujiaquan.com
- 981888.20231998.com
- yuan.9178.com
- www.0149.com
- c9178e.7zp.top
- www878uu.com
- cao1234.com
- 799334.com
- www.aq333399.com
- njbd.bdjsi.com
- xxc.com
- subang2016.com
- hosting ip address lookup history
- 107.165.228.84
- 40.73.113.101
- 47.107.71.104
- 183.47.112.78
- 104.202.5.2
- 104.16.141.96
- 123.1.194.55
- 91.209.182.15
- 118.107.32.139
- 156.226.112.91
- 103.38.82.113
- 154.197.228.189
- 103.125.115.50
- 104.103.80.93
- 121.170.185.200
- 154.201.241.99
- 222.76.218.82
- 120.24.181.251
- 36.170.53.167
- 172.18.8.12
